Abstract

The utility model discloses an emergency mechanism of a lamp, which is detachably connected with the lamp and comprises a control box, an emergency lamp body, a connecting body and a connecting body, wherein an emergency power supply is arranged in the control box, the emergency lamp body is connected with the control box through a mounting frame and is positioned at the outer side of the lamp, the connecting body is internally provided with a connecting hole, and can axially penetrate through the connecting hole and is connected with the lamp, and a movable groove for radial movement of the connecting body is formed in the whole body of the connecting hole. The utility model can be added to Highbay lamps with different sizes for use, provides an emergency lighting function, and is convenient for leveling.

Emergency mechanism of lamp Technical Field The utility model relates to the technical field of lighting devices, in particular to an emergency mechanism of a lamp. Background The lamp is one of common illumination tools, wherein Highbay lamps, also called high ceiling lamps, are suitable for high and large spaces, are suitable for illumination with large area, high brightness and uniformity, and at present, the lamp has an emergency function, can assist in illumination when a normal power supply has a problem, such as an industrial and mining lamp with the emergency function disclosed in the patent number CN206036741U, and the emergency lamp and the illumination lamp are assembled in the lamp together, are of a structure formed together with the lamp, and cannot be added to the high ceiling lamps with different sizes for use. Disclosure of utility model The utility model provides an emergency mechanism of a lamp with high adaptation degree, which aims to avoid the defects existing in the prior art. The utility model solves the technical problems by adopting the following technical scheme that the emergency mechanism of the lamp is detachably connected with the lamp and comprises: The control box is internally provided with an emergency power supply; The emergency lamp body is connected with the control box through the mounting frame and is positioned at the outer side of the lamp; The connecting body is internally provided with a connecting hole, and can axially penetrate through the connecting hole and be connected with the lamp; Wherein, the whole body of the connecting hole is provided with a movable groove for the connecting body to move radially. In several embodiments, an installation space is provided in the middle of the control box, and the coupling hole is provided at the bottom of the installation space. In several embodiments, the connector includes a limiting section and a connecting section, the connecting section passes through the connecting hole and is connected with the lamp, and the limiting section is located above the connecting hole and cannot pass through the connecting hole. In several embodiments, the control box includes a main box body and a box cover covering one side of the opening of the main box body, a first accommodating shell is arranged in the middle of the main box body, the installation space is surrounded by the first accommodating shell, and an opening is formed in the box cover and is communicated with the installation space. In several embodiments, a second accommodating case is disposed at one side in the main case, and an emergency power supply is disposed in the second accommodating case. In several embodiments, a plurality of slots are arranged on one side of the main box body away from the second accommodating shell, and a balancing weight is arranged in the slots, and the weight of the balancing weight is matched with the weight of the emergency power supply. In several embodiments, a level gauge is provided on the lid. In several embodiments, the control box is provided with a guide rail towards one side of the lamp, and the mounting frame is arranged in the guide rail and can move along the guide rail. In several embodiments, the guide rail is provided with scale information on the outside. The utility model has the beneficial effects that: The utility model can be added to Highbay lamps with different sizes for use, and provides an emergency lighting function. The utility model can adjust the position of the control box and ensure the stability through the matching of the connector, the movable groove and the level meter. The utility model can adjust the position of the emergency lamp body, is suitable for lamps with different sizes, and ensures the illumination effect of the emergency lamp body. The utility model ensures the weight balance through the balancing weight.
